Q: Is 65,374,774 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 65,374,774 is not a prime number.

Why is 65,374,774 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 65374774 can be evenly divided by 1 2 127 254 257,381 514,762 32,687,387 and 65,374,774, with no remainder.

Since 65,374,774 cannot be divided by just 1 and 65,374,774, it is not a prime number.
